Let It All Soak In: A Rain Garden Webinar
Rain gardens: a stunning landscape feature and storm water device all in one! They are features that offer a unique way to protect the water quality of your local creek, lake or the Columbia River while spiffing up the garden at the same time. Come away with a solid understanding of raingardens--their benefits, suitable locations and tools for design and installation. Have a look at lovely rain garden plants for sun or shade and become familiar with the Rain Garden Handbook for Western Washington Homeowners. After this 90-minute webinar by Colleen Miko, you'll be ready to tame the rain. This webinar is put on by the WSU Clark County Extension Master Gardener Program in collaboration with Clark County Public Health -Solid Waste Outreach.
